An aimed alkoxycarbonylfluoroalkanesulfonic acid salt is obtained by using a halofluoroalkanoic acid ester as a starting raw material, and by sulfinating the ester in the presence of an amine (step 1) and then oxidizing the resulting product (step 2). By salt exchanging the thus-obtained alkoxycarbonylfluoroalkanesulfonic acid salt (step 3), there can be obtained an alkoxycarbonylfluoroalkanesulfonic acid onium salt which is useful as a photoacid generator. |
